Transaction ef815ec64d5a564e096c54a460cf4d77152de9538006c5d531d5319308a1a102
1 Input
1 Output
-
ef815ec64d5a564e096c54a460cf4d77152de9538006c5d531d5319308a1a102:0
- value
- 38712
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ec84b27315512cc1f0aedf5cbf484cf556609af9
- address
- bc1qajztyuc42ykvru9wmawt7jzv74txpxhe5k9vs9